A permanent extradition treaty between Israel and Belgium was initiated by representatives of both states at a ceremony yesterday at the Foreign Office here.
The conclusion of the pact came at the end of three weeks of negotiations. The new pact will replace a temporary arrangement which had been in effect previously. Israel is currently negotiating a number of such treaties with countries in Western Europe.
